Course Content

• Urban Wildlife Ecology & Conservation
• Human-Wildlife Conflict Resolution & Management
• Wildlife Habitat Restoration & Enhancement in Urban Environments
• Urban Wildlife Education & Interpretation Techniques
• Community Engagement & Citizen Science for Urban Wildlife Conservation
• Policy & Legislation Affecting Urban Wildlife
• Data Collection & Analysis for Urban Wildlife Monitoring
• Communicating Urban Wildlife Science to Diverse Audiences

Career path

Career Role Description
Urban Wildlife Conservation Officer Protecting and managing urban wildlife populations; habitat restoration and creation; community engagement. High demand for practical skills.
Wildlife Education Officer (Urban Focus) Developing and delivering engaging educational programs on urban wildlife conservation; strong communication and outreach skills crucial. Growing job market.
Urban Biodiversity Consultant Advising on urban development projects to minimize impact on wildlife; ecological assessments; report writing. Excellent salary potential.
Environmental Outreach Specialist (Urban Wildlife) Raising awareness about urban wildlife conservation issues; community events and campaigns; strong advocacy skills. High demand.
